Cincinnati Bengals wide receiver Tee Higgins has returned to the NFL's concussion protocol following symptoms that emerged after a head injury during the team's Week 14 loss to the Buffalo Bills. Despite being cleared to play multiple times during the game, Higgins' situation has sparked backlash against the league's handling of the incident. The 26-year-old receiver emphasized his commitment to the team in postgame comments.
Victor Wembanyama powered the San Antonio Spurs to a 114-93 victory over the Portland Trail Blazers in Game 4 of their first-round playoff series, taking a 3-1 lead. The star center, who missed Game 3 due to a concussion from Game 2, recorded 27 points, 11 rebounds, seven blocks and three steals. He praised his team's medical staff but expressed frustration with how the NBA handled the return-to-play process.
